Output 890aaad45c9ae59b29f999b228aba9083bae53988740b0a05a70170e4511c1fe:7

value
19716027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b384d49fb72ac2fda1a9878582dbc81efafcc988 OP_EQUAL
address
MQGNJznSqjCauKRhALU4NJx9LqxzhyBxKY
transaction
890aaad45c9ae59b29f999b228aba9083bae53988740b0a05a70170e4511c1fe
spent
true